diff options
Diffstat (limited to 'arch/arm/mach-mvebu/Kconfig')
-rw-r--r-- | arch/arm/mach-mvebu/Kconfig |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/arch/arm/mach-mvebu/Kconfig b/arch/arm/mach-mvebu/Kconfig index f15d3cc5edb..a320793a305 100644 --- a/arch/arm/mach-mvebu/Kconfig +++ b/arch/arm/mach-mvebu/Kconfig @@ -250,6 +250,16 @@ config DDR_LOG_LEVEL At level 3, rovides the windows margin of each DQ as a results of DQS centeralization. +config DDR_IMMUTABLE_DEBUG_SETTINGS + bool "Immutable DDR debug level (always DEBUG_LEVEL_ERROR)" + depends on ARMADA_38X + help + Makes the DDR training code debug level settings immutable. + The debug level setting from board topology definition is ignored. + The debug level is always set to DEBUG_LEVEL_ERROR and register + dumps are disabled. + This can save around 10 KiB of space in SPL binary. + config DDR_RESET_ON_TRAINING_FAILURE bool "Reset the board on DDR training failure instead of hanging" depends on ARMADA_38X || ARMADA_XP |